Fully Qualified Vehicle Mechanic

David Taylor Garages is a family-run business that has been serving our local community for over 50 years. We are currently seeking a Fully qualified vehicle technician to join our team and help us continue to provide our customers with exceptional service. A high percentage of vehicles that go through our workshops are pickup trucks, so an interest in commercial vehicles would be preferable.

Responsibilities:

-       Perform routine vehicle maintenance tasks, including oil changes, tire rotations, and brake inspections, to ensure vehicles are operating efficiently and safely.

-       Diagnose and repair mechanical and electrical issues in vehicles, utilising diagnostic tools and equipment to identify problems accurately.

-       Conduct thorough vehicle inspections to assess overall condition and identify potential issues that require attention.

-       Complete repairs and maintenance tasks efficiently and in accordance with manufacturer guidelines and industry standards.

-       Maintain accurate records of all maintenance and repair work performed on vehicles, including parts used and labour hours.

-       Communicate effectively with customers to explain repairs needed and address any questions or concerns.

-       Stay up to date with advancements in automotive technology and participate in ongoing training to enhance skills and knowledge.

-       Always adhere to safety protocols and regulations to ensure a safe working environment for yourself and others.

-       Work with other members of the service team to prioritise workload and meet deadlines effectively.

-       Maintain a clean and organised work area, including tools, equipment, and service bays, to ensure a professional and efficient work environment.

 

Requirements:

-       Fully qualified vehicle technician.

-   MOT tester preferable but not essential, providing you are willing to achieve the certification

-       Proficiency in diagnosing and repairing mechanical and electrical issues in vehicles.

-       Strong attention to detail and problem-solving skills.

-       Ability to work independently and as part of a team.

-       Strong communication and customer service skills.

-       Ability to work in a fast-paced environment with excellent time management skills.

-       Must hold a clean driving license.
